Description:
1H-Indole-5-ethanesulfonamide, N-methyl-3-(1-methyl-4-piperidinyl)-, hydrochloride (1:1), with CAS number 143388-64-1, is a chemical compound characterized by its complex structure, which includes an indole ring, a sulfonamide group, and a piperidine moiety. This compound typically appears as a white to off-white solid and is soluble in water and various organic solvents, making it versatile for different applications. The presence of the sulfonamide group contributes to its potential biological activity, often associated with pharmacological properties. The piperidine ring enhances its interaction with biological targets, which may include receptors or enzymes. As a hydrochloride salt, it is stabilized in its ionic form, which can influence its solubility and bioavailability. This compound is of interest in medicinal chemistry and drug development, particularly for its potential therapeutic effects. However, specific safety and handling guidelines should be followed, as with all chemical substances, due to the potential for toxicity or adverse reactions.
